Cleaning a fuel pump

#1 Post by DriveWFO » Sun Feb 12, 2006 1:04 pm

I have a Victor fuel pump that had alcohol run through it at some point. It looks like there's some type of white corrosive substance on the inside of the pump. The pump has a new rebuild kit in it. Should I be worried about that white stuff, or should I attempt to clean it somehow???

#2 Post by John_Heard » Sun Feb 12, 2006 1:39 pm

That's real common with alky, yes you should be worried about it... it'll get into the carb if you put it on like that. Take it apart and clean all the white corrosion out of it.
